site stats

Bubble sort with generics java

WebAlgorithm 插入排序与冒泡排序的比较,algorithm,sorting,runtime,bubble-sort,insertion-sort,Algorithm,Sorting,Runtime,Bubble Sort,Insertion Sort,我正试图找出这两种算法执行的实际时间,我发现在许多地方与互联网上的信息不一致,这表明插入排序更好。然而,我发现冒泡排序执行得更快。WebMar 31, 2024 · Time Complexity: O(N 2) Auxiliary Space: O(1) Worst Case Analysis for Bubble Sort: The worst-case condition for bubble sort occurs when elements of the array are arranged in decreasing order. In the …

Algorithm 插入排序与冒泡排序的比较_Algorithm_Sorting_Runtime_Bubble Sort…

http://duoduokou.com/algorithm/27088893261628384088.htmlWeb2 days ago · Here we have written the possible algorithm, by which we can sort the array elements in a descending order. Step 1 − Start. Step 2 − SET temp =0. Step 3 − Declare an array to put the data. Step 4 − Initialize the array with arr [] = {5, 2, 8, 7, 1 }. Step 5 − Print "Elements of Original Array". essentials of physical chemistry pdf https://bruelphoto.com

Insertion Sort Algorithm using Generics in Java - The Code …

WebJan 18, 2014 · This is done because the code to sort in ascending or descending order is pretty much the same, the difference is just one small detail. The Sorter Abstract class and the Sortable Interface were explained on the previous tutorial. 01. public class InsertionSort extends Sorter implements Sortable {. 02.WebJan 17, 2014 · Every sorting algorithm that we are going to create will have at least 2 public methods, which are: sortAscending and sortDescending. To make sure this will always be true, we are going to create an Interface called Sortable. 1. public interface Sortable {. 2. … You can see on the code below that the sortAscending and sortDescending … Eswar Kommu on Bubble Sort Algorithm using Generics in Java; Luciano … WebBubble Sort Overview. Bubble sort is the simplest sorting algorithm. It works by iterating the input array from the first element to the last, comparing each pair of elements and swapping them if needed. Bubble sort continues its iterations until no more swaps are needed. This algorithm is not suitable for large datasets as its average and ... essentials of physical anthropology larsen

Generic Example of Selection Sort in Java - Big-O

Category:Java Program to Sort the Array Elements in Descending Order

Tags:Bubble sort with generics java

Bubble sort with generics java

Generics in Java - GeeksforGeeks

WebIterations. Below are the iterations performed in Bubble Sort in Java which is as follows: First Iteration [6 1 8 5 3] – It starts by comparing the first two numbers and shifts the lesser number of the two to its right.Hence among 6 and 1, 1 is the smaller number that is shifted to the left and 6 to the right.WebThe following Java program develops a class BubbleSort that contains a parameterized static generic method bubbleSort for any base type T. Note that Java provides the java.util.Comparable interface that contains a single method, compareTo. Any class that correctly implements this interface guarantees a total ordering of its instances.

Bubble sort with generics java

Did you know?

<t>WebJun 13, 2024 · Java Program for Bubble Sort; Bubble Sort Algorithm; Program to check if a given number is Lucky (all digits are different) Lucky Numbers; Write a program to …

WebJava (Generic) Generic Bubble Sort in Java. Below is a generic example of the Bubble Sort algorithm in Java.See the Bubble Sort page for more information and … </t>

WebMar 22, 2024 · Bubble sort is the simplest of all sorting techniques in Java. This technique sorts the collection by repeatedly comparing two adjacent elements and swapping them if they are not in the desired order. Thus, at the end of the iteration, the heaviest element gets bubbled up to claim its rightful position. If there are n elements in list A given ... WebSep 29, 2013 · Edited to add: Actually, as SLaks together point out, there's no real reason for Sort to be generic; you just need the bubbleSort method to be generic. Further, as …

WebJava Program. Write a program with the two following generic methods using a bubble sort. The first method sorts the elements using the Comparable interface, and the second uses the Comparator interface. public static &gt; void bubbleSort(E[] list) public static void bubbleSort(E[] list, Comparator …

WebApr 2, 2024 · As a reminder, sort.Interface is an interface defined in Go's sort package, and looks like this: type Interface interface { Len() int Less(i, j int) bool Swap(i, j int) } The sort package also provides useful type adapters to imbue sort.Interface onto common slice types. For example, sort.StringSlice makes a []string implement this interface in ... essentials of pharmacology for nurses 2015WebFeb 14, 2015 · I am currently working on making my own Generic Bubble Sorting which can easily sort Strings, int. Below is my Code for Normal Bubble Sorting.Can you help me out how to create a generic Method Of this? public static void BubbleSorting () { int Swap; for (int outer = Length; outer >= 1; outer--) { for (int inner = 0; inner < outer - 1; inner++ ... fire and salt restaurant johnstownWebBubble Sort. In this tutorial, you will learn about the bubble sort algorithm and its implementation in Python, Java, C, and C++. Bubble sort is a sorting algorithm that compares two adjacent elements and swaps them …essentials of physical geology